Combo in sig. Made 512hp 628tq on a mustang dyno with a very very conservative tune with only 16 degrees of timing.

60' 1.57 easy launch 8psi off brake. Needs 12-15
1/8 et 6.71
1/8 mph 106mph
1/4 et 10.44
1/4 mph 129.9.
